India Celebrated Raksha Bandhan on Aug. 2

The festival of love between sisters and brothers, known as Raksha Bandhan or Rakhi Festival, is being celebrated across India on Aug. 2, 2012 with full enthusiasm.

The central ceremony involves the tying of a sacred thread, Rakhi by a sister on her brother's wrist. This symbolizes the sister's love and prayers for her brother's well being, and the brother's vow to protect her long life.

President Pranab Mukherjee, Vice-President Mohammad Hamid Ansari and Prime Minister Dr Manmohan Singh have greeted the nation on the occasion.
